    What Was First Touchscreen Phone

    The LG KE850 was the first touchscreen phone. It was marketed as the LG Prada and was similar to other touchscreen phones that were released later on. The KE850 had hardware buttons on the front underneath a capacitive touchscreen. Some strange spec decisions were made with the phone, such as the inclusion of hardware buttons instead of a touchscreen. Despite these flaws, the KE850 was the first touchscreen phone and set the stage for future touchscreen phone releases.

    What Are Brick Phones

    Brick phones were the first cell phones available to the public. These phones were made out of heavy plastic and resembled a brick you would find in a building. They were very large and heavy, and were not easy to carry around.

    When Did Flip Phones Come Out

    When did flip phones come out?

    The StarTAC, created by Motorola in 1996, was the phone that started the whole revolution of flip phones. Most people college age or older probably had some sort of flip phone in their life before the iPhone was introduced. Flip phones were popular in the late 1990s and early 2000s, but they eventually lost popularity to newer, more advanced phones.
